Wealth management firms typically offer comprehensive services through a team of professionals, serving high-net-worth clients with a broad range of financial solutions. Financial advisors often work independently or within firms, focusing on personalized financial planning and investment advice. While both hold similar credentials, wealth management firms provide a more extensive, team-based approach, whereas financial advisors tend to offer more individualized services.
